Will Retail Renew Post Covid-19?

View descriptionShare
 

The Financial Times reports that almost 630,000 retail outlets in the US have been forced to close due to Covid-19 fears. As further shutdowns are implemented across the US and people are staying home, there is little to no income coming in for non-essential retailers.

The National Retail Federation calculates that the industry could lose $430 billion in revenues over the next three months.

How many stores will be able to reopen if and when the crisis passes?
